The Arizona Cardinals tried to turn lemons into lemonade against the Carolina Panthers on Saturday evening but were dragged down by one of the worst quarterback efforts in postseason history during a 27-16 loss.
While Ryan Lindley authored an incredibly woeful effort (16 of 28, 82 yards, TD, 2 INT), the father of Cardinals backup quarterback Logan Thomas fumed on Twitter:
You can’t blame Eddie Thomas for being upset. His son couldn’t even supplant the dreadful Lindley, who will be remembered for quarterbacking the 2014 NFL equivalent of the Titanic.
Arizona’s 77 total yards is the fewest amount gained by a team in NFL postseason history.
